| Fire and | To comply with UL 985 and 864 listing standards for fire alarm systems (effective March 1, 1989), the | |||
|
|
| Fire/Burglary | total combined continuous and alarm current draw for the system during alarm conditions must be | |||
|
|
| Systems | limited to 1.4 A provided by the primary power supply (rectified AC). If current draw for the system | |||
|
|
|
| exceeds 1.4 A, remove connected devices until the current draw falls below 1.4 A. Then, connect the | |||
|
|
|
| removed devices to a D8132 Battery Charger Module or to an external power supply (refer to | |||
|
|
|
| Figure 25 on page 55). | |||
